    • Newspaper Obituary - December 27, 1946 Oswego Palladium Times - Fulton Funerals - Newton N. Ward - Fulton - Funeral of Newton N. Ward, 68, who died Wednesday night at his home in Granby after a lingering illness, will be held at 2:30 p.m. Saturday at the home with Rev. Luther Ridgeway, pastor of Granby church, officiating. Burial will be in Mount Adnah Cemetery. Mr. Ward had been a resident of Granby 20 years. He was a member of the Granby Center Methodist church. Suriving are his wife, Mrs. Jennie Ward; three sons, Elmer Ward, serving with the Marine Corps at Tientain, China; Erwin Ward, Fulton, and Newton Ward Jr., Granby; two daughters, Mrs. Blanche Mangano and Miss Rhoda Ward, Granby; and four grandchildren, Barbara Jean and Mary Ward, and Judy Ann and Jimmy Mangano.

      Newspaper Obituary - Thursday, January 2, 1947 Fulton Patriot - Ward - Died at his home in Granby, Dec. 25, Newton N. Ward, aged 66 years. He is survived by his wife Mrs. Jennie Ward, three sons, Edwin of Fulton, Marine Elmer Ward of Tientsen China, and Newton Jr. of Granby, two daughters, Mrs. Blanche Mangano and Miss Rhoda Ward and four grandchildren. Funeral services were held from the home Saturday afternoon, Rev. Luther Ridgeway officiating, intemrent in Mt. Adnah.
